#!/usr/bin/env python2
#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
# Author ......: Sotirios M. Roussis aka. xtonousou <xtonousou@gmail.com>
# Date ........: 20170628
"""
Translate any text into Greeklish, print on stdout, write to file/s
"""
try:
from sys import argv, platform, stdin
import locale
import codecs as cs
try:
import dictionaries as d
except ImportError:
print 'You must have the \'dictionaries.py\' file in the script\' s directory to continue'
exit()
try:
from googletrans import Translator
except ImportError:
if platform == "linux" or platform == "linux2":
print 'You must run \'sudo python2 -m pip install -r requirements.txt\' first'
elif platform == "darwin":
print 'You must run \'sudo pip install -r requirements.txt\' first'
elif platform == "win32":
print 'You must run \'pip install -r requirements.txt\' first'
exit()
except KeyboardInterrupt:
print '\nexit'
exit()
SCRIPT_NAME = argv[0].strip('.')[::-1].strip('.')[3:][::-1]
SCRIPT_VERSION = '1.1.0'
def version_message():
"""
Prints the script's name with the version
@return: exit()
"""
print SCRIPT_NAME + ' ' + SCRIPT_VERSION
return exit()
def help_message():
"""
Prints all the available script's options
@return: exit()
"""
print
print ' Version: ' + SCRIPT_VERSION
print
print ' Usage: ' + SCRIPT_NAME + ' [options]'
print
print ' Translate any text into Greeklish, print on stdout, write to file/s'
print
print ' Options:'
print ' -t|--translate translate into Greeklish'
print ' -w|--write write to \'.' + SCRIPT_NAME + '\' files'
print ' -h|--help output usage information'
print ' -v|--version output the version number'
print
return exit()
def print_messages(messages):
"""
Prints out a list line by line
@param messages: the list to be printed
"""
for message in messages:
print message.strip()
def get_arg_list(arg):
"""
Creates and returns a list of arguments
@param arg: {'h', 't', 'v', 'w'}
@return arg_list: a list with the available arguments
"""
if arg == 'h':
arg_list = ['-h', '--help']
elif arg == 't':
arg_list = ['-t', '--translate']
elif arg == 'v':
arg_list = ['-v', '--version']
elif arg == 'w':
arg_list = ['-w', '--write']
return arg_list
def read_file_to_list(file_):
"""
Reads a file and converts it to a list
@param file_: the file to be read
@return [word for ... in line]: the converted word list
"""
return [word for line in cs.open(file_, 'r', 'utf-8') for word in line]
def read_file_by_char_to_list(file_):
"""old-style-class
Reads a file char by char and creates a list with those chars
@param file_: the file to be read
@return data: a char list
"""
data = []
buffer_ = cs.open(file_, 'r', 'utf-8')
for line in buffer_:
data.extend(line)
return data
def to_greeklish(list_):
"""
Converts a char list to Greeklish using 'dictionaries' file
@param list_: a char list e.g. list_ = ['a', 'b']
@return tmp: a char list that contains the translated text
"""
tmp = [None] * 999999
for char in xrange(0, len(list_)):
char_dict = d.get_char_dict()
uchar = list_[char].encode('utf-8')
if uchar in char_dict:
tmp[char] = char_dict.get(uchar)
else:
tmp[char] = list_[char]
return [c for c in tmp if c is not None]
def cat(lang):
"""
Translate any text into Greeklish by [typing + enter]
@param lang: a string to check which mode to activate {'greek', anything}
"""
if lang == 'greek':
while True:
try:
text = raw_input().decode(stdin.encoding
or locale.getpreferredencoding(True))
new_data = to_greeklish(list(text))
print ''.join(new_data)
except KeyboardInterrupt:
print '\nexit'
exit()
else:
while True:
try:
text = raw_input().decode(stdin.encoding
or locale.getpreferredencoding(True))
translated = Translator().translate(''.join(text), dest='el')
new_data = to_greeklish(list(unicode(translated.text)))
print ''.join(new_data)
except KeyboardInterrupt:
print '\nexit'
exit()
def print_or_write_list(arg, flag, count_t):
"""
Prints list or writes to file/s
@param arg: each file
@param flag: boolean value
@param count_t: how many times a 'translate' argument is passed
@return flag: the boolean value to keep 'write' sanity between multiple files
@return messages: a list containing current 'SUCCESS' and 'FAILURE' messages
"""
messages = []
try:
if not flag:
if count_t > 0:
data = read_file_to_list(arg)
translated = Translator().translate(''.join(data), dest='el')
new_data = to_greeklish(list(unicode(translated.text)))
elif count_t < 1:
new_data = to_greeklish(read_file_by_char_to_list(arg))
print 'File \'' + arg + '\'' + ':' + '\n'
print ''.join(new_data)
print '\n' + '----------------------------------------' + '\n'
elif flag:
if count_t > 0:
data = read_file_to_list(arg)
translated = Translator().translate(''.join(data), dest='el')
new_data = to_greeklish(list(unicode(translated.text)))
elif count_t < 1:
new_data = to_greeklish(read_file_by_char_to_list(arg))
d.get_color_dict().get('OKGREEN')
messages.append(d.get_color_dict().get('OKGREEN') + '✓ ' +
d.get_color_dict().get('ENDC') + '\'' + arg +
'\' file has been translated successfully' + '\n')
flag = False
# Write to file/s
buffer_ = cs.open(str(arg) + '.grklsh', 'w', 'utf-8')
for char in xrange(0, len(new_data)):
buffer_.write(new_data[char])
except IOError as error:
messages.append(
d.get_color_dict().get('FAIL') + '✗ ' +
d.get_color_dict().get('ENDC') + 'I/O error({0}): {1} {2}'
.format(error.errno, error.strerror, '\'' + arg + '\'')
)
return flag, messages
def main(args):
"""
The main function; parsing command line arguments; write to files
@param args: all command line arguments after the first e.g. argv[1:]
"""
all_messages = []
messages = []
flag = False
count_t = 0
count_w = 0
if len(args) < 1:
cat('greek')
else:
for arg in args:
# translate
if arg in get_arg_list('t'):
count_t += 1
if len(args) < 2:
cat('other')
continue
# write
elif arg in get_arg_list('w'):
if count_t > 0 and len(args) % 2 == 0:
print d.get_color_dict().get('WARNING') + \
'You need to specify which files to translate' + \
d.get_color_dict().get('ENDC')
exit()
count_w += 1
if len(args) > 1:
flag = True
continue
else:
print d.get_color_dict().get('WARNING') + \
'You need to specify which files to translate' + \
d.get_color_dict().get('ENDC')
exit()
flag, messages = print_or_write_list(
arg, flag, count_t)
all_messages += messages
# help
elif arg in get_arg_list('h'):
help_message()
# version
elif arg in get_arg_list('v'):
version_message()
else:
flag, messages = print_or_write_list(
arg, flag, count_t)
all_messages += messages
print_messages(all_messages)
if __name__ == '__main__':
main(argv[1:])
